5. What rights do I have?

As we collect personal data about you, you have some rights that we would like to make you aware of.

You have the right to:

* To receive information about a processing of your personal data (duty to provide information)

* To gain insight into your personal data (right of access)

* To have incorrect personal data corrected (the right to rectification)

* To have your personal data deleted (the right to be forgotten)

* To object to the use of personal data for direct marketing

* Moving your personal data (data portability)

 

Right to access personal information

You have the right to gain insight into the personal data that Single Relations processes about you, cf. Article 15 of the Personal Data Ordinance. Access may, however, be restricted for reasons of trade secrets and / or intellectual property rights.

Correction or deletion of personal data

If you believe that the information that Single Relations (epow) processes about you is incorrect or incorrect, you have the right to have it corrected or deleted, in accordance with Articles 16 and 17 of the Personal Data Regulation.

If we agree with you that the information we process is incorrect or incorrect, we will delete or correct this information as soon as possible.

However, deletion will not take place if Single Relations (epow) is legally obliged to store all or part of your personal data, or it is necessary to store this personal data in order for a legal claim to be established or defended. In that case, Single Relations (epow) will only store the information to which Single Relations (epow) is legally obliged or entitled and will delete other personal data about you.

To have your information completely or partially deleted or to have a consent withdrawn in whole or in part, please contact us by E-mail: info@singlerelations.com

 

Withdrawal of consent

You have the right to withdraw your consent to Single Relations (epow) processing of your personal data in whole or in part at any time, in accordance with Article 7 of the Personal Data Regulation.

If you withdraw your consent, Single Relations (epow) will cease to process the personal data to which you have revoked your consent in relation to, unless Single Relations (epow) is legally obliged or entitled to store all or part of your personal data . In that case, Single Relations (epow) will only store the information to which Single Relations (epow) is legally obliged and will delete other personal data about you. Your withdrawal of your consent does not affect the lawfulness of the processing that Single Relations (epow) has conducted until your withdrawal of the consent.

If you withdraw your consent to the processing of data necessary for the use of Single Relations (epow), we will be forced to delete all of your data, as your profile will not function without this necessary data.

To withdraw your consent in part, you can simply delete the data you no longer want us to process, this is possible with the list of voluntary information mentioned above, as well as the different types of emails you receive. You can e.g. withdraw the consent to receive e-mails with offers in return, by simply pressing “Unsubscribe” in such e-mail.

To withdraw your consent completely, simply delete your profile. You can do this under Menu / “My profile” -> “My settings”. After this, it usually takes 30 days before we delete the data completely.

 

Alternatively, you can always contact us by email info@singlerelations.com and have the data deleted with immediate effect.

 

Objection

You have the right to object to Single Relations (epow) processing of your personal data at any time. You can also object if you believe that your personal data is being processed in violation of applicable rules or the consent you have given to Single Relations (epow), in accordance with Article 21 of the Personal Data Regulation.

 

Restriction

You have the right to have limited Single Relations (epow) processing of your personal data in the following cases, cf. Article 18 of the Personal Data Regulation:

* While Single Relations (epow) processes an objection that you have made against the accuracy of the personal data that Single Relations (epow) processes about you or against the legality of the processing. The limitation of processing applies until Single Relations (epow) has completed processing your objection.

* Single Relations (epow) processing is illegal, but you do not want the deletion of the information, but only that the use of personal data is restricted.

 

Data portability

When our processing of your personal data is based on consent or a contract, and our processing is carried out automatically, you have the right to data portability.

The right to data portability means that you have the right to receive the personal data that you have provided to us in a structured, commonly used and machine-readable format, which you have the right to transfer to another service provider, in accordance with Article 20 of the Personal Data Regulation.

If you wish to make use of one or more of these rights, simply contact info@singlerelations.com with your request.

We will process and respond to your inquiry as soon as possible and no later than one month after we receive your inquiry, unless the complexity and scope of the request means that we are unable to respond within one month. In that case, the deadline for reply may be up to 3 months in total, in accordance with Article 12 of the Personal Data Regulation.
